Update from Dave Loader, BNH Crime Prevention Specialist
DURING THE 2023/24 financial year, Business North Harbour (BNH) received an allocation of funding from Auckland Council to spend on crime prevention for our business community.
As you know, we already provide a nightly security patrol service across our business area with our partners, Vanguard Security Ltd. To enhance these patrols, we used part of the funding to provide a 24/7 patrol coverage of our total area between 23 December 2023 and 7 January 2024. This period is when most businesses are locked up for the Christmas/New Year holiday break, so they are potentially more vulnerable to criminal activity. It was pleasing to see that, during this period, we only received three reported incidents of crime, which were all, thankfully, low-level.
The remainder of the funding has been spent on CCTV road coverage cameras at six locations around our Business Improvement District (BID). These complement the existing Auckland Transport camera network located around our BID’s perimeter. Footage from these cameras is supplied, when requested, to NZ Police for any criminal investigations that may occur. Vanguard Security checks our community camera network of six locations every night, as part of efforts to keep our business community, its assets and people as safe as possible.
BNH would like to acknowledge the three members who have allowed us to mount CCTV cameras on their premises. These have given us extra road coverage to assist in identifying offender vehicles associated with criminal activity.
